Obituary for Doris "Cookie" Lynch

Doris “Cookie” Lynch, 70, of Good Hope, passed away Tuesday morning, November 3, 2015, at her residence surrounded by her loving family and under the care of Amedisys Hospice. She was born in Baltimore, MD, on February 6, 1945, a daughter of the late Lloyd Wayne Hammond and Lalah Mae McVicker Hammond.
She is survived by her devoted husband of 51 years, Gerald Lynch, whom she married July 24, 1964.
Also surviving are two daughters, Dawn Cummings and her husband Scott, Cumberland, RI, and Kerri Hoffman, Kitty Hawk, NC, and a grandson, Jacob Hoffman, Kitty Hawk, NC.
Cookie was a member of New Bethel United Methodist Church, where she was the co-founder of “His Hands Ministry.” She loved scrapbooking, and she had worked as a receptionist in various dental offices in the area.

In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ions in Cookie’s memory are asked to be made to “His Hands Ministry”, in c/o Kay Gibson, 75 Shay Drive, Jane Lew, WV 26378
A service to celebrate Cookie’s life will be held at 3 p.m. on Sunday, November 22, 2015, at New Bethel United Methodist Church, Good Hope, with Reverend Destry Daniels presiding.
